产品对比更新于 2026-05-13

InchStack 与 DBA 客户端的边界

说明 InchStack 与 DBeaver、Navicat、SSMS 等 DBA 客户端的分工:DBA 客户端负责单库深度操作,InchStack 负责跨角色、跨流程、带证据的 AI 数据工作。

适用对象

DBA数据工程师数据库运维团队技术负责人

核心结论

  • DBA 客户端是数据库操作工具,不应承担全部业务交付流程。
  • InchStack 不追求替代 DBeaver、Navicat 或 SSMS 的单库深度能力。
  • 跨角色协作、AI 建议审核和交付证据沉淀,是 InchStack 更适合的位置。

DBeaver、Navicat、SSMS 等 DBA 客户端,是数据库开发和运维中非常成熟的工具。它们适合连接数据库、查看表结构、执行 SQL、管理对象、调试查询和处理单库级别的日常操作。对专业 DBA 和数据工程师来说,这些工具仍然不可替代。

但企业里的数据问题通常不是单纯的数据库操作。一个迁移评估、指标治理、性能诊断或数据交付项目,会涉及业务方、数据工程师、DBA、分析师、项目负责人和外部实施伙伴。每个角色关心的内容不同,最终还需要形成可交付、可解释、可复查的材料。

InchStack 的边界不是做一个更强的 SQL 客户端,而是把数据库操作放进更完整的数据工作流程中。SQL、表结构、执行结果和诊断结论可以成为证据,但它们需要和业务问题、治理规则、AI 建议、人工审批、质量验证和交付回执一起组织。

AI 进一步放大了这个差异。让模型生成 SQL 或诊断建议只是第一步,更关键的是判断建议是否适合当前环境、是否符合权限和安全边界、是否经过人工确认、是否留下执行前后的证据。DBA 客户端一般不会完整管理这些上下文。

对于数据库运维团队,InchStack 可以作为“专业责任层”。例如一次慢查询诊断,不只是给出优化 SQL,还要记录问题背景、采样范围、执行计划、风险判断、建议优先级、实施窗口和回滚边界。这样项目结束后,团队仍然能解释当时为什么这么处理。

因此,已有 DBA 客户端的团队不需要迁移工具习惯。更现实的方式是继续用熟悉的客户端完成底层操作,同时用 InchStack 管理跨角色流程和交付证据。这样既保留专业工具效率,也让 AI 数据工作更容易被团队和客户信任。

常见问题

InchStack 是 DBA 工具吗?

不是传统 DBA 客户端。它更像数据工作和 AI 辅助交付的控制面,可以引用数据库操作结果,但不以替代单库管理工具为目标。

DBA 团队什么情况下适合使用 InchStack?

当工作涉及跨角色协作、诊断报告、治理规则、交付证据、AI 建议审核或客户项目复盘时,InchStack 会比单纯 SQL 客户端更合适。

下一步